Office Budget Planning
Planning a seamless office move? A well-structured budget is essential to guarantee a affordable and successful transition. This thorough guide provides insightful tips on crafting an office moving budget that optimizes your savings while accounting for all necessary expenses.
- Start by pinpointing all potential costs. This encompasses everything from shipping and self-storage to technology setup and officefurniture.
- Research different vendors for each area. Obtaining quotes from multiple sources will help you discover the most advantageous prices.
- Consider your existing workplace and determine if any adjustments are needed. This can help in cutting down on renovation costs.
- Rank expenses based on their necessity. Allocate your budget accordingly, ensuring that critical needs are met first.
- Don't overlook to factor a contingency fund of 15% into your budget. This will provide a buffer for unexpected expenditures.

Pack Smart, Save Big: Essential Tips for Cost-Effective Office Relocations
Moving your office can be a daunting task, but it doesn't have to break the bank. By utilizing some smart tricks, you can save significant amounts of money while ensuring a smooth transition.
Here are some essential tips for securing a cost-effective office relocation:
* Start planning early to enhance your budget and avoid last-minute charges.
* Purge your office space by donating unnecessary items. This not only saves on storage costs but also simplifies the move itself.
* Obtain quotes from multiple moving companies to ensure the best possible rates. Don't be afraid to bargain pricing and services to reduce expenses.
* Investigate alternative transportation methods, such as renting a truck, to may save money on professional moving services.
* Organize your own belongings whenever possible. This not only saves effort but also allows you to manage the packing process and prevent damage to valuable items.
By following these suggestions, you can successfully relocate your office while keeping to your budget.
